I've read in numerous articles and posts that the Canucks' first rounder Cory Schneider will be going to Boston College and starting this fall. I've never seen young Mr Schneider play and I don't know the strength of BC's program, in defense of a potentially stupid question. Is Schneider that good that he can go in as a freshman and be a starter or are the current gumpers not that strong?

Im pretty sure that BC has three returning goalies, but I dont think that any of them were particularily good last year, there starter, Matti Kaltiainen, had a great record and GAA, but that can be mostly credited to the strenght of the rest of Boston College's hockey team (they were ranked first for alot of last year, until they started struggling during the end of the season), but his save percentage was only .907, which for playing on a great team, is not very good...

So, to answer your question, BC has a great program, but is in need of a good starter, and I wouldnt be surprised at all if Schneider gets the nod next year

OTOH, we saw BC make Adam Pineault play 4th line and ride the pine because he did not close the gap of the older talented kids in front of him.

Matti Kaltiainen got BC to the Froozen Four this year. I would venture to say that York won't play Schneider simply because he is unhappy about his returning guys. Schneider will be doing quite well this year if he plays close to 50% of BCs games.
